HIPS Hedge Fund Activity: Q1 2018 in Review
5 of the 4,363 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in GraniteShares HIPS US High Income ETF (HIPS) for Q1 2018, worth a combined $1.03M — down 33% from $1.54M a quarter earlier.
Buyers outnumbered sellers: 1 fund opened new HIPS positions and 0 closed out — a net gain of 1 holder — while 0 added to existing stakes and 3 trimmed.
The largest buyer was Jane Street, opening a new position worth an estimated $526K. The largest seller was Bramshill Investments, cutting an estimated $915K.
